Azerbaijan allocates land for construction of solar power plant in Baku

Tokyo, 27 December, /AJMEDIA/

The Azerbaijani Cabinet of Ministers has ordered to allocate over 300 hectares of land in Pirsaat settlement of Garadagh district of Baku for construction of a solar power plant (SPP), AJMEDIA reports.

The relevant decree was signed by Prime Minister Ali Asadov.

The document was published on the government’s website.

According to the document, 300.77 hectares of land of the State Reserve Fund is defined as a zone of renewable energy sources for construction of the SPP.

Azerbaijan’s Ministry of Energy is ordered to select a power producer, the State Committee for Architecture and Urban Planning is ordered to issue a permit for construction of the power plant.
